Occupant Classification Sensor - Vehicles With: NAS Specification (G2312034): Installation
-
CAUTION: The occupant classification sensor service kit must not be separated and it must be installed as provided.
Install the Occupant Classification Sensor (OCS) kit and secure it wit the 2 clips.
- Reposition the hose as shown.
- Reposition the Occupant Classification Sensor (OCS).
- Install and tighten the bolt.
Torque : 2 Nm
- Connect the electrical connector.
-
NOTE:
- Use hog ring pliers to close the hog rings. Do not use any other tool. The hog rings must be closed to overlap as illustrated.
- Make sure that new hog rings are installed.
- Install the front row seat cushion cover.
- Install the 20 new hog rings in the sequence shown.
General Equipment: hog ring plier
Renew Part: Hog rings Quantity: 20 .
- Secure the velcro strap.
- Install the front row seat cushion assembly.
- Secure the 3 retainers at the front of the cushion.
- Secure the 3 retainers at the back of the cushion.
- Connect the front row seat heater element electrical connector.
- Secure the 2 front row seat backrest cover retainers.

- Connect the startup battery ground cable.
Refer to: 12V SYSTEM DISCONNECT .
-
CAUTION: The following pre-cautions are required to run the routine correctly.: Seat is empty, ignition is switched on, the occupancy seat module has gone through the seat assembly plant calibration, no collision event received from the Restraints Control Module (RCM) during the current ignition cycle, no faults present in the current ignition cycle, occupancy seat module has settled for 10 seconds, temperature is between 6°C (42°F) and 36°C (97°F), seat is bolted in original installation position.
Using the Jaguar Land Rover (JLR) approved diagnostic equipment, perform routine - Learn Seat Occupant Classification Zero Position (5007).
General Equipment: Jaguar Land Rover approved diagnostic equipment
